In the early morning hours once a month, as a truckload of Feed the Valley food pallets is unloaded, a neighborhood begins to emerge to help pack and distribute 150 food boxes. They greet Cody and Lilly Wing, the neighborhood’s missionaries through Take the City’s Project Lifehouse– strategically placed homes that reach the neighborhood community for Christ.
A few years earlier, Steve & Kristen Bedsole discovered during COVID that food drives would be beneficial for the neighborhood. A local church, the Verge, with Pastor Chuck Odum, was inspired to come alongside and help. That’s when the Wings came on the scene.
As time passed, the Wings realized that the neighbors desired a true community– they were already holding block parties, for instance– but weren’t clear on the next thing to do to make it a reality, until the monthly food drives inspired them. “We found the heart of the neighborhood, which was not just come, get, go,” Cody said. “When they saw we were committed, they began to not only pick up a box, but began to help to distribute them and set up/tear down. They started serving each other.”
“Every month as we get together,” Lilly shared, “we pick one word we want to speak over our neighborhood and pray into that. They’re always ready to pray over what they want to see decrease and what needs to increase.” The sense of community addresses intangibles like loneliness and hopelessness and tangibly lifts the spirits of everyone involved.
People are also drawn to the Wings’ Lifehouse and frequently visit. One adolescent boy came onto the porch, just because “it feels comfortable and makes me feel safe.” Since then, he has started to hang out with Cody, helping him with projects.“Forging relationships are the key in trying to build community,” Cody reflected.
Even those still trapped in addiction come around and help every month, explaining, “Y’all are good people and are doing good things.” “Ultimately,” said Lilly, with Cody nodding in agreement, “we show them the One True good thing.”
